* tests: port to NFS file servers with clock skewPaul Eggert2010-10-151-1/+1
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Several of the tests assumed that a newly created file cannot have a time stamp dated in the future. This assumption is not true when files are served by a remote host whose clock is slightly in advance of ours. * Improve listed incremental dumps.Sergey Poznyakoff2009-08-071-2/+1
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The modified algorithm tries to avoid dumping the same directory twice and ensures the order of the directories in the resulting archive is the same, whatever their order on the command line.
